Haveri Lok Sabha Election Result 2019

Karnataka · Parliament (Lok Sabha) Election 2019 GEN

Udasi. S.C. of Bharatiya Janata Party won the Haveri Lok Sabha constituency in Karnataka in the 2019 general election, with a winning margin of 140,882 votes (11.10%).

10 candidates contested this seat. The constituency had 1,680,025 registered electors and 1,266,679 votes were polled, recording a turnout of 75.80%. Full candidate-wise vote breakdown, vote shares, and constituency statistics are below.

Position Candidate Name Party Votes Vote %
1 Udasi. S.C. Bharatiya Janta Party 683,660 54.00%
2 D.R. Patil Indian National Congress 542,778 42.90%
3 Ayubakhan A Pathan Bahujan Samaj Party 7,479 0.60%
4 Ishwar Patil Uttama Prajaakeeya Party 7,024 0.60%
5 Hanumanthappa.D.Kabbar Independent 6,247 0.50%
6 Siddappa. Kallappa. Poojar Independent 5,858 0.50%
7 Veerabhadrappa Veerappa Kabbinada Urf Bandi Independent 2,283 0.20%
8 Bommoji. Ramappa. Siddappa Independent 1,389 0.10%
9 Basavaraj. S. Desai Independent 1,305 0.10%
10 Shylesh Nazare Ashok Indian Labour Party (Ambedkar Phule) 1,244 0.10%
